Method and apparatus for coupling two wheeled vehicles
A method and apparatus are provided for coupling a first and second wheeled vehicle. The apparatus includes a first area with a stop to engage an undersurface of the first wheeled vehicle and a second area with spaced apart openings to receive wheels of the second vehicle. The apparatus also includes a hook member positioned between the first and second areas and including surfaces to engage a perimeter of the frame of the first wheeled vehicle. The method includes engaging a perimeter of the frame of the first wheeled vehicle with the hook member. The method further includes rotating the stop about an engagement point between the hook member and the frame of the first wheeled vehicle until the stop engages an undersurface of the frame. The method further includes positioning a pair of wheels of the second vehicle in the spaced apart openings.

Pallet train
The pallet train is a series of platforms, that are mounted on wheels and casters and can be linked to other platforms to form a train to haul freight inside a freight trailer includes: a platform, multiple perimeter stops on the outside of the platform, net hooks mounted on two sides of the platform that connect to nets, a pair of nets that wrap over the top of the freight to hold freight down, four casters on the bottom surface, a metal carriage assembly that features pop pins that engage with the tow bar, a tow bar slidably mounted inside the carriage assembly to connect the platforms to each other, metal strips on the corners to protect from damage, an optional tray slidably mounted on the platform using four metal posts that is adjustable for height, and a pop pin puller to disengage the pop pins.

Road finishing machine with pushing device
The disclosure relates to a road finishing machine with a chassis and a pushing device. The pushing device comprises at least one docking assembly and at least one absorber unit. The absorber unit is fixed to the chassis of the road finishing machine and comprises at least one piston-cylinder unit which comprises a cylinder and a working piston movable therein which subdivides the piston-cylinder unit into at least one first and one second chambers and is coupled to the docking assembly. The docking assembly may be positioned, by the movably mounted working piston, relative to the chassis between an extended position and at least one retracted position. In the piston-cylinder unit, at least one flow channel is provided between the first and the second chambers for letting a fluid enclosed in the piston-cylinder unit pass through, the fluid being prestressed in the extended position.
